Curriculum
The MS in Business Analytics program teaches students techniques such as:
- Forecasting
- Data visualization
- Optimization
- Machine learning
The program consists of eight core courses, which cover the foundations of business analytics. Students can then select electives to focus on areas of concentration, such as:
- Information systems
- Statistics
- Modeling
- Healthcare management
- Operations
- Finance
- Accounting Students may also choose to pursue a customized concentration with the approval of the department head.
Program Options
The degree can be customized to fit the needs of professionals with any schedule, with full-time, part-time, and online delivery options. The program can be completed in:
- 18 months (full-time)
- 24 to 36 months (part-time)

Graduate Certificates and Minors
The program offers graduate certificates in business analytics, which are stackable and can be applied towards the MS in Business Analytics degree. Recommended areas of study that complement business analytics proficiencies include:
- Digital supply chain
- Marketing
- Finance
- Computer science
Dual Degrees
Students can also choose to pursue another LeBow graduate degree, with the ability to share up to 15 credits between two degree programs, allowing students to maximize their time and financial investment.
